Discusses those people who came to the United States from the British Isles as the settlers of new English colonies and, later, as immigrants seeking a home in a new nation. Includes a chronology of the U.S. immigration laws.

"Discusses the reasons for the immigration of Eastern Europeans to the United States in the late nineteenth and early twentieth centuries and describes the hardships, persecutions, and intolerable living and working conditions that many had to endure until they gained some measure of acceptance in their new homeland."@en
